#1 make sure you create a log of your original settings before you do anything and keep a list of each change you make step by step. Only do 1 change at a time so if anything goes bad you can change it back.
#2 I'm pretty sure depending what DRL setting you selected, DRL's will only work with the truck running and in gear.
#3 Not sure what happened to your grid lines.
#4 Some changes are not instant and require several key cycles and sometimes overnight or longer.

Have patience because it will all work out in the end and you'll be very, very happy.

When connected to Alfa in the BCM under car configuration change scroll nearly all the way down the list below the CSMs and you’ll find the dynamic and static grid line settings. Make sure dynamic is actually enabled.

I know my key vendor has to send premarried fobs to someone to unlock, he pays $25 a piece. A dealer might be able to but hes been doing this a long time and he tells me Chrysler/BMW/Mercedes/Fiat keys all need to be flashed if they were married to a vehicle before.
